If you use Google Maps frequently, you can set a shortcut on your Desktop. So you don't have to type the address in your Browser.

Desktop shortcut for Google Maps create

  1. Click with the right mouse button on a free spot on your desktop.
  2. From the context menu, select "New" and then click on "link".
  3. A new window will appear. In the field "Enter the location of the item:" add the address "https://www.google.de/maps/" (without the quotation marks).
  4. Then click on "Next".
  5. Give the shortcut a name, for example "Google Maps", and click "Finish".
  6. On your Desktop is a link to Google Maps is now. Double-click the new Icon, it will open Google Maps directly in your default browser.
